Anne Hagen is having lunch in a fast food restaurant with her best friend Jimmy and her father, when a suicidal gunman opens fire, killing her father and others. Winged Creatures tracks the survivors struggle to live with the choices they made that day, and to regain trust in the ordinary world.Anne develops a religious hysteria and becomes revered by the town - but blackmails Jimmy into muteness, all to protect the secret that nearly destroys him and his already fractured family. Charlie, a devoted father and driving-school teacher, walks away with a bullet graze, and attempts to press his luck at a casino. Fear and loneliness drive the restaurant cashier, Carla, into desperation, and she begins to neglect her infant son. ER physician Dr Laraby fails to save the shooting victims, and turns to his wife as someone to save. Psychologist Ron Abler tries to help the survivors deal with the aftermath, but meets resistance - the repression and denial that must surround the memory of the event itself.Winged Creatures explodes the myth of closure with an after-the-cameras-go-home look at the real and lasting trauma of gun violence - ordinary people driven by secret torments and dangerous compulsions, in flight from their own memories and dreams.
